POST-OFFICE NOTICES.
Monday, October 23. For Kaikoura and Wellington, per Tui, at 4.45 p.m. Tuesday, October 24. Mails per Axawata will close as under— For the United Kingdom, via Brindisi and Southampton, at 1.20 p.m.; late letters, 1,40 p.m. For the Continent of Europe, via France, Italy, or Trieste, at 1 p.m.; late letters, 1.20 p.m. For Point de Galle, India, China, and the East, Aden, Mauritius, Reunion, Natal, Cape of Good Hope, Suez, the Mediterranean ports, America, &c, &c, at 1 p.m, ; late letters, 1.20 p.m. For Otagc and Australian Colonies, at 1.20 p.m. ; late letters, 1.40 p.m. Registered letters and money orders, noon. Newspapers and book packets, 12.30 p.m. Late letters for transmission perR.M.S. Arawata, can be posted in the guard’s van railway station by the 2.30 p.m. train to Lyttolton, provided such letters bear, in addition to the full postage, a further single rate of postage as a late fee. J. J. FXTZGIBBON, Chief Postmaster.
